    14 Important Do’s & Don’ts for Travel During Mercury Retrograde

    by Trudy Wendelin, L.Ac April 13, 2025
    written by Trudy Wendelin, L.Ac

    The planet Mercury governs travel, so it’s especially important to be aware of Mercury Retrograde Cycles when travel planning. Mercury Retrograde (MRx) affects everything approximately 12 weeks/year, so it’s essential to know how to ride this cosmic wave, so you can come out sailing…Besides travel, Mercury also governs transportation, technology, communication, education & speed.  As an Astrologer & avid traveler, I’m sharing these 14 Do’s & Don’ts on travel during Mercury Retrograde because this is so important!!!


    What is Mercury Retrograde (MRx)?

    Mercury the Messenger

    With Mercury Retrograde (MRx), it appears (an illusion) to be going backwards in the sky due to Earth’s orbit passing by Mercury.  Astrologically, this disrupts all energies related to Mercury leading to problems with technology, transportation and travel and communication.  However, if you listen to this change, this can be a productive period to transform, so your energies flow even better after Mercury goes direct.  This happens for approx. 3 weeks every 3 months, and are best handled, if planned for to make changes in your life (dates at end of blog) to adapt.  

    This time asks everyone to slow down and check in with how we manifest Mercury in our lives.  Where are you spinning your wheels or inefficient?   Overall, it’s not a time to start something new, because it’s a pause in life for reintegrating, reprocessing and recycling our lives to learn from the past.   

    The Roman God, Mercury, is the Messenger.  Being the fastest moving planet, this astrological maverick corresponds with many things, such as, speed, travel, technology, information, communication, transportation, education, thievery & commerce.  With his winged hat and shoes, loftily he carries the winged, healing staff or Caduceus. Mercury also rules our health related to the nervous system, eyes and upper limbs.

         14 Do’s and Don’ts for Travel During Mercury Retrograde

    1.  Do Manifest the “Re” Words:   This is a nice time for a Wellness or Spa Retreat to slow down and unwind, relax, reflect, rejuvenate and recharge.  Also, it can also be a good time to plan and research future itineraries.  Travel during this time is not about seeing something new. Instead, it’s more about a venue that allows us to take pause and reintegrate our lives. 

    2.  Use Retrograde Energies to Your Advantage:  This can be a productive time to reintegrate our past travel experiences by editing old photos and videos.  It’s also a good time to write or journal, enabling us to process experiences.  Furthermore, it’s an innovative time to refine our technology skills with cameras, phones and computers.  Also, this is a good time to revise a travel blog or vlog.

    3.  Do Not Sign any Contracts:  Because you are more vulnerable to miscommunication during this period, this is not a good time for signing ANY contracts.

    4.  Do Get Travel Insurance:  This assures protection against changes and cancellations in itinerary or schedule.

    5.  Do Slow Down & Arrive Early:   For appointments and arrivals give wiggle room for schedule changes or cancellations.

    6.  Don’t Rely on Technology:   There’s more likely to be computer crashes, technological problems, WIFI issues, miscommunication in e-mails and texts, and disruptions with anything electronic.  Therefore, this is a great time to pretend it’s 1990 and unplug from technology and communicate in person.

    7.  Polish Your Communication Skills:  With foreign travel, brush up on the basics of your destination’s language and, thus, be aware of what offends the culture’s people.

    8.  Do Check in with Your Eye Health:  Mercury rules the eyes and vision, so this is a good time for an eye exam or purchase of new glasses.  Consider getting shades with blue light filter to protect from technology.  Lutein, Bilberry, Vitamin A and Omega 3 fish oils are nourishing for eye health.

    9.  Do Take a Time Out with Social Media:  Slow down and reassess your persona on Social Media.  Are you authentic and portraying yourself in the best light?  Overall, be more cautious with posts, to avoid miscommunication and unnecessarily offending others. 

    10.  Do Tune up Your Listening Skills:  With the modern world of 24/7 stimulation, tuning up our listening skills will allow us to learn more from people, win more friends, polish our interpersonal communication skills and avoid miscommunication. 

    11.  Do Strengthen and Optimize Upper Limbs:  Mercury rules the upper limbs, so this is a productive time to update your ergonomics. For example, this is the perfect time to address computer (prevent carpal tunnel and tendonitis) posture to avoid “Tech Neck,” and reassess travelling gear to optimize balance for keeping your upper limbs healthy.

    12.  Do Relax or Recharge your Nervous System:  Mercury rules the Nervous System, so this is a wonderful time to relax, rejuvenate and recharge your Nervous System through retreats, time-outs, nature breaks, Adaptogens (ex. Rhodiola, Ashwaghanda) to lower cortisol, and Vitamin B-complex supplements.  Mentally, this is an ideal time to improve attitudes and belief systems to ensure less stress for our nervous system.   Additionally, explore ways to manage stress with meditation and Energetic Medicine.

    13.  Do Improve Travel Security & Safety:  Mercury rules thievery, so take time to foolproof your travel bags, money and gear.  Travelling makes you vulnerable, so its important to think out your plans and safeguard with money belts or hiding your money, Also, it’s time to consider important documents and personal safety.  Perhaps, take a self-defense course, get pepper spray or mace, or get contact information for safety.

    14.  Do Recharge Your Sense of Humor and Fun Factor:  Mercury the Trickster reminds you to have a little fun and not forget your sense of humor.  Therefore, this is an ideal time for a stress-relieving, fun vacation to lighten up!


    Mercury Retrograde Schedule 2025 – 2026

    March 15 – April 17 in Aries and Pisces
    July 18 – August 11 in Leo
    November 9 – 29 in Sagittarius and Scorpio

The Greek Theatre of Taormina was created by the G The Greek Theatre of Taormina was created by the Greeks in 3rd Century BC. Later the Romans transformed it for use of games and gladiator battles. This archeological site is one of the main attractions in Taormina and still a venue for entertainments today, such as, symphonies, theatre and ballets. 

Look at the view of Mt. Etna (Europe's most active volcano) in the background!

Doing a Northern Ireland Causeway Coastal tour sho Doing a Northern Ireland Causeway Coastal tour should be on everyone’s bucket list. It’s well-known for being one of the most beautiful drives in the world with many scenic stops along the way. Its breathtaking castles, geological wonders and magical coastlines offer the ultimate road trip. Because my day here was so incredible, I love sharing my tips about the Ireland Causeway Coastal Tour to Giant’s Causeway, Dunluce Castle and Dark Hedges. For Game of Thrones fans, this is a special trip going to 2 film locations for the popular series.

Causeway Coastal Route goes along the northern coast of Northern Ireland 193 km (120 m) between Belfast & Londonderry. My one-day tour from Belfast included the iconic sites, such as, Giant’s Causeway, Dunluce Castle and Dark Hedges. Other incredible stops on the route are Carrick-a-Rede Rope Bridge, Carrickfergus Castle, Gobbins Cliff Path, Ballintoy Harbour, Glenarm Castle and Torr Head.
